Instructions

Step 1

Decide if the person is eligible for a nursing home. Remember that according to the federal law "On guardianship and guardianship", such institutions are mainly defined by single men over 60 years old and women over 55 years old, disabled groups I and II (by disease or age), war veterans.

Step 2

Contact the regional center for social protection of the population at your place of residence, receive and fill out an application form of the established sample, and then an application for placement in a nursing home, according to which the social protection commission will decide on the placement of custody and guardianship of incapacity.

Step 3

If it is necessary to keep an old man in a psycho-neurological boarding school, a conclusion of a commission of doctors, consisting of at least three specialists, including a psychiatrist, is required. In this case, the resume will indicate a mental disorder that makes it impossible for a person to stay in a regular social security institution.

Step 4

Please note that an elderly person will be admitted to a nursing home only if there is a special medical decision about his health and safety for others. It will be based on an extract from the medical history, drawn up in a hospital or polyclinic at the place of residence, with the diagnoses of the following specialist doctors - therapist, dermatovenerologist, psychiatrist, narcologist, oncologist, phthisiatrician, infectious disease specialist.

Step 5

For women, a gynecologist's examination is required. In addition, the results of a blood test for HIV, the result of fluorography, and for the disabled, a medical program for individual rehabilitation.
